The BEST WESTERN Monticello Gateway Inn lies at the focal point of unique Monticello and Piatt counties, on Interstate 72 in the central Illinois community. This prairie community proudly displays sites and events continuously through the year, with a special emphasis on the 2,000 acres of native plains and upland forest that make up beautiful Allerton Park, a Registered Natural Landmark.
